Cost of Initial Application

The cost of applying a roof coating for the first time can vary widely based on the chosen materials and the size of the roof. Typically, facility managers should budget between $1.50 to $4.00 per square foot for this important investment. While the upfront costs may seem intimidating, selecting a high-quality, durable coating will yield returns over time.

A robust coating protects against weather extremes and UV damage, which significantly lowers future repair expenses. Additionally, it’s vital to account for labor costs, as hiring professionals ensures proper adherence and lasting performance of the coating.

By investing in a quality coating upfront, property owners can prevent more serious issues down the road. Also, it’s wise to consider warranties that may cover repairs and help extend the life of the coating. Planning for these initial expenses is essential to ensure they fit into the overall budget.

Maintenance and Repair Expenses

After a roof coating is applied, ongoing maintenance costs become crucial to consider. Typically, allocating about 1-3% of the roof’s replacement value annually for upkeep is advisable. Regular inspections and prompt minor repairs help prevent costly damage before it escalates.

Even seemingly small leaks can turn into major problems, causing extensive water damage and necessitating expensive repairs inside the building. Establishing a maintenance schedule enables facility managers to address minor issues proactively, ultimately saving money in the long run.

It’s also helpful to keep detailed records of inspections, repairs, and maintenance activities. This documentation facilitates identifying patterns that could point to larger issues, aiding in effective budgeting while minimizing unexpected expenses. Investing in advanced technology for inspections can streamline this process and improve accuracy.

Identifying Potential Damage Areas

Proactively spotting damage areas is vital for extending the life of commercial roof coatings. Regular visual inspections should focus on seams, flashings, and penetrations, which are common leak points.

Signs of coating damage, such as blistering, peeling, or cracking, should not be overlooked. Addressing these issues early can prevent them from developing into more serious problems down the road.

Advanced technologies like thermal imaging can reveal hidden moisture under coatings, allowing facility managers to execute targeted repairs and ward off extensive damage.

Mitigating Water Ponding and Leaks

Water ponding is a significant threat to the integrity of commercial roof coatings. When water collects, it can degrade protective membranes and cause leaks, making effective drainage systems vital.

Facility managers should ensure that gutters and downspouts are regularly cleared to maintain optimal water flow. Proper roof design should also include sloping to guide water away from pooling areas.

If ponding is unavoidable, consider installing specialized roofing systems designed to handle standing water, thereby reducing the risk of leaks and prolonging the life of the roof coating.

Regular Inspection Schedules

Creating a regular inspection schedule is essential for keeping roof coatings in top shape. Facility managers should conduct inspections at least twice a year and right after extreme weather events. This approach helps catch potential issues early, like blisters and cracks, which can worsen if ignored.

During each inspection, evaluating the overall condition of the roof coating is crucial, looking for signs of wear or discoloration that may need immediate attention. Utilizing a checklist can ensure all important areas are properly assessed, reducing the chance of overlooking significant issues.

Thorough documentation of inspection results is vital. This record should include any repairs undertaken and areas that require future attention. Keeping detailed data helps with long-term maintenance planning and budgeting. For enhanced insights, consider using drones or thermal imaging tech, which can safely identify issues undetectable by standard visual checks.

Cleaning and Debris Removal Methods

Consistent cleaning and debris removal are essential for maintaining roof performance. Accumulated debris like leaves, branches, and dirt can trap moisture, leading to mold and mildew growth that damages the roof coating and reduces energy efficiency.

Cleaning should be scheduled at least quarterly, escalating during the fall when leaves and debris volumes peak. Employing soft washing techniques allows for effective cleaning without harming the coating’s surface.

Monitoring drainage systems is equally important to prevent blockages that could lead to standing water. Make sure to clear any debris from gutters and downspouts regularly to ensure effective drainage. Complementing cleaning with specialized eco-friendly cleaners can further enhance the coating’s longevity by minimizing corrosion and surface discoloration.

Addressing and Sealing Damages

Swiftly addressing any damages is a critical piece of operational procedures. Small issues, such as cracks or punctures, can quickly turn into larger problems if not immediately tended to. Regular inspections should help catch these damages early.

Once identified, sealing damages with compatible roofing sealants is crucial. Effective sealing prevents water infiltration and protects against further degradation of the roof coating. Always use high-quality, manufacturer-recommended products for the best results.

Training facility staff on how to perform simple repairs can empower them to act swiftly when minor issues arise. This proactive strategy can reduce repair costs and minimize roof downtime. Engaging a professional roofing contractor for complex repairs ensures that significant issues are resolved properly and in a timely manner.
